What Makes an SEO Tool "Agency-Ready"?
Before diving into the specific platforms, it is important to understand the criteria that differentiate a basic SEO tool from one created for firms. An agency-grade tool must provide:
Multi-Client Management: The capability to switch in between accounts or projects effortlessly.White-Label Reporting: Customizing reports with the agency's branding and logo.Collaborative Features: Multi-user gain access to with varying consent levels.Scalability: API access and high data limitations to manage large-scale websites.Integration: The capability to sync with Google Search Console, GA4, and CRM systems.1. All-in-One SEO Suites
All-in-one suites are the "Swiss Army Knives" of the market. They cover whatever from keyword research and backlink analysis to site auditing.
Semrush
Semrush is commonly considered the industry leader for agencies. Its "Agency Growth Kit" is particularly designed to help firms discover brand-new leads and automate customer reporting. Semrush deals one of the most extensive databases for keyword research and competitor intelligence.
Ahrefs
Ahrefs is popular for having the world's biggest index of live backlinks. For companies focused on link-building and technical SEO, Ahrefs is indispensable. Its Site Explorer and Content Explorer tools offer deep insights into what is working for rivals.
SE Ranking
For shop firms or those managing smaller sized budget plans, SE Ranking offers a powerful alternative to the "big two." It provides precise rank tracking, site audits, and white-labeling at a more accessible cost point.

Technical SEO and Crawling Tools While all-in-one tools have crawlers,devoted technical tools offer a much deeper check out a website's architecture. These are vital for agencies dealing with large e-commerce sites or enterprise customers. Yelling Frog SEO Spider: A desktop-based program that crawls sites toidentify damaged links, audit reroutes, and analyze page titles. For firms, the paid version is obligatory to crawl more than 500 URLs. Sitebulb: This tool is praised for its information visualization and"Hint"system, which helps agency groups focus on technical repairs based upon their potential impact.
DeepCrawl (Lumar): An enterprise-level cloud spider. It is ideal for companies handling sites with millions of pages where desktop crawling is no longer practical. 3. Techniques for Building an AgencyToolstack Building an efficient toolstack is not about having the most tools; it has to do with having the right ones that collaborate. The majority of successful firms follow a "Tiered Stack"approach: TheFoundation: One" All-in-One" suite(Semrush or Ahrefs)for the bulk of the research study and tracking. The Specialist: One technical spider(Screaming Frog)and one local SEO tool (BrightLocal).The Communicator: One dedicated reporting tool(AgencyAnalytics)to equate data into client-friendly insights. By combining tools where possible, firms can decrease costs and minimize thetime invested training personnel on several user interfaces.
